Your storage space is not expandable. You will need to delete or move your space hogging files like videos, movies, photos, etc. to an external drive. Then you can delete those from your internal drive. You need to maintain a minimum of 10 - 15 GB of empty space at all times for the OS to function. And the upgrade to Big Sur requires 35 - 45 GB of empty space to download, expand the installer, and install. By the way, if you fill up your drive completely, your computer will simply stop functioning.
